The best method for removing a bicycle freewheel without causing damage is to use a bicycle freewheel removal tool. This tool is specifically designed to fit the freewheel and allow for easy removal without damaging the bike. Simply attach the removal tool to the freewheel and use a wrench to turn it counterclockwise to loosen and remove the freewheel.

The best bicycle gear removal tool for efficiently and effectively removing gears from a bicycle is a cassette lockring tool. This tool is specifically designed to securely grip the lockring on the cassette, allowing you to easily loosen and remove the gears.

A bicycle crank puller is a tool used to remove the crank arms from a bicycle. It helps by providing a way to safely and effectively detach the crank arms from the bottom bracket spindle without causing damage to the components. This tool is essential for maintenance and repair tasks on a bicycle, allowing for easy removal and replacement of the crank arms.
The best method for removing a Shimano cassette without causing damage is to use a specific tool called a cassette removal tool. This tool is designed to fit into the splines on the cassette lockring and allow you to loosen and remove it without damaging the cassette or the hub. It is recommended to use this tool to ensure a smooth and safe removal process.

To perform a bottom bracket removal on your bicycle, you will need specific tools such as a bottom bracket tool and a wrench. Start by removing the crank arms, then use the bottom bracket tool to unscrew the bottom bracket from the frame. Clean the area and apply grease before installing a new bottom bracket if needed.
